2 LAST MEETING GREENVILLE (Nov. 1, 1997) Derek Russell and Stuart Rentz combined for a pair of fourth quarter touchdowns to spark a 17-point rally and lift Furman past upset minded Elon in front of 7,817 fans at Paladin Stadium. Trailing at the half, Furman took the lead for good early in the third quarter when Mark Moore scored on a 13-yard run. After Elon cut Furman's lead to with a 42-yard field goal on the final play of the period, the Paladins answered with a 26-yard Jason Wells field goal, a 20-yard touchdown run by Derek Russell, and a 38-yard scoring dash by Stuart Rentz for the game's final margin. Paced by the rushing of Ernest Crosby (114 yards) and Mark Moore (103 yards), Furman rolled a season high 365 yards on the ground and outgained the Fightin' Christians in total offense. F E First Downs 22 8 Rushing Passing C/A/I Total Offense Fumbles-Lost Penalties Punts Possession Time 31:46 28:14 Third Down Conversions Sacks By 1 3 NOTING THE PALADINS FURMAN TO OPEN 94TH SEASON...The 1999 season opener against Elon will mark the beginning of the 94th season of football at Furman University. The first school in South Carolina (along with Wofford) to begin playing football, Furman since 1889 has rolled up a record. A member of the Southern Conference since 1936, Furman has captured nine league championships ( ) the most of any current Southern Conference member school. Furman was also the first conference school to win an NCAA I-AA national championship when it captured the title in 1988 by defeating Georgia Southern (at the time an NCAA I-AA independent) to culminate a school best 13-2 season. BOBBY JOHNSON: YEAR SIX...The 1999 season will be Furman head coach Bobby Johnson's sixth year at the helm of the Paladin program and 22nd season of service to the university. After suffering through a 3-8 season in 1994 (the program's first losing season since 1979 and worst record since 1972), Furman rebounded in 1995 to finish 6-5. A year later Johnson, a Columbia native and 1973 Clemson graduate, directed the Paladins to a 9-4 record and into the NCAA I-AA playoffs the program's first playoff appearance since Furman went 7-4 in 1997 and 5-6 a year ago. Johnson's fouryear head coaching record is (.526), and his last four teams have combined to post a slate (.587). Against NCAA I-AA competition, Furman teams under Johnson's direction have gone (.567). Johnson's 21-year tenure includes work as defensive backs coach, assistant head coach, defensive coordinator, and head coach. The Paladins' record during that span ( ; 82-92; 94-present) is (.664). FURMAN LOOKING TO IMPROVE RECORD IN SEASON OPENERS...Furman hasn't had much success in recent season openers, having posted a 1-4 mark in its last five lid lifters. Furman's season inaugural opponents, however, have had a lot to do with that lack of success, as the Paladins' last five season opening foes have included Clemson (1994, '96, & '98), Georgia Tech (1995), and Samford (1997). Saturday's game against Elon will mark the first time Furman has played a season opener in Paladin Stadium since 1993, when Furman knocked off Connecticut Overall Furman is 5-4 in season openers in the 1990s. An outstanding tackler, Keith began the 1998 campaign by recording a career high 19 tackles in a loss to Clemson, but late in the Paladins' third game (34-24 win over Samford), he sustained a deep sprain in his right foot, which effectively sidelined him for the next three games and limited his effectiveness the rest of the season. Still, he tallied 56 tackles and earned Furman's Best Defensive Back Award. Forced to sit out spring practice after undergoing post-season surgery, Keith will serve as a team co-captain this fall along with strong safety Walter Booth, offensive guard Ben Hall, and tailback Stuart Rentz. Despite the injury plagued 1998 campaign, Keith has totaled 1,481 plays, 188 tackles, and eight interceptions in his career. One of those eight pickoffs was returned a school record 99 yards in a Furman win over Chattanooga during the 1997 season. WELLS TAKING AIM...Furman senior placekicker Jason Wells (Lawton, Okla.), a preseason All-Southern Conference selection, is poised to leave his mark on the school's kick scoring and overall scoring charts. For Wells, who initially came to Furman to play soccer, the 1999 campaign should afford him an opportunity to bounce back from a 1998 season that saw him hampered with a bone spur in his left (plant) foot. Despite the injury, he still converted 11x18 FGs and 30x30 PATs, led Furman in scoring (63 points) for a second straight season and, in the process, moved onto the school's career kick scoring and scoring ledgers. Successful postseason surgery and plenty of work this summer, including some with Atlanta Falcons' kicker Morten Anderson, appears to have paid off for Wells, who converted 4x4 FGs, including a 48-yarder into the wind, in Furman's biggest scrimmage of the preseason. Wells' career numbers include 29x49 FGs (.591) and 100x104 PATs (.961). Cain, who in 1997 and '98 served as head coach at Southern Conference rival VMI, worked 11 seasons as receivers coach and offensive coordinator at North Carolina State ( ) before going to VMI. Cain began his coaching career at Furman in 1977, and from served as passing game coordinator and tight ends/receivers coach under former Paladin mentor Dick Sheridan. During that span, Furman captured six Southern Conference championships. MAKING THE MOVE...Sophomore Louis Ivory (Fort Valley, Ga.) has been penciled in as the Paladins' probable starting tailback in this Saturday's season opener against Elon. Ivory's move from fullback to tailback, which had been considered by the coaching staff since spring practice, is an attempt by Furman to jump start its option based ground game, which hasn't produced a 1,000-yard rusher since Carl Tremble ran for 1,555 yards in A year ago Ivory began the season in fine fashion, rushing for 202 yards and two touchdowns in the Paladins' first two games, before ankle injuries slowed his production. He finished the year with 406 yards and four touchdowns (5.1 ypa). IN SEARCH OF (A PASS RUSH)...Two years ago Furman paced the Southern Conference with 32 quarterback sacks, but last year, following the graduation of All-America defensive end Bryan Dailer, the Paladins slipped all the way to eighth, with only nine takedowns. That figure will have to improve if Furman is to register notable improvement on defense this fall. On the defensive front, senior strong tackle Brian Conner (Knoxville, Tenn.) leads all returning defensive linemen with 5.5 career sacks. NOTING ELON...Two years ago a very young Elon team came into Paladin Stadium and gave Furman a very tough game, building a halftime lead before falling This year, with many of the same cast of players two years older and more experienced, Elon will attempt to make an early season statement against the Paladins. The Fightin' Christians, a former NCAA Division II power as a member of the rugged South Atlantic Conference, made the move to NCAA I- AA in 1997, and last year finished 5-6 against a tough schedule that included a 36-0 blowout of Samford in the season finale. This year Elon is thinking NCAA I-AA playoffs, and with all 22 starters returning, there are more than a few I-AA football observers who believe the Fightin' Christians' post-season playoff designs deserve serious merit. Under the direction of Al Seagraves the past four seasons, Elon has methodically implemented and perfected the wishbone offense, which last year generated rushing yards per game. Junior quarterback Derrick Moore, the Fightin' Christians' leading rusher a year ago (834 yards), returns and has a choice of experienced backs behind him, including seniors Steven Ferguson (743 yards in '98) and Daren Bethea (465 yards in '98). Up front,tackle Tim Holliday and center Chip Brogden were in the starting lineup two years ago against Furman. After yielding 365 rushing yards to the loss to the Paladins in 1997, Elon has made dramatic improvement on defense, surrendering only yards per game to opponents in That type of performance should continue this year with the return of a host of veterans, including a talented linebacking corps headed up by junior Roger Allen, the squad's leading tackler (77 stops, 11 tackles-for-loss) a year ago, and senior Kyle Hinshaw (43 tackles in '98). Three of the Fightin' Christians' probable starters on the defensive line, ends Philip Solomon and Jerome Nelson (team high 10 sacks in '98), and nose guard Mark Boseman, were regulars the last time Elon paid a visit to Paladin Stadium, as were all four defensive backs.
